Holiday Bacon-Blueberry Stuffing
Servings: 4
Prep Time: 20 min
Cook Time: 20 min
Directions
- In a large nonstick pan or pot over medium heat, brown bacon, celery and onion until the bacon is just under crispy. Add orange juice or champagne and bring to a low boil, stirring frequently. Turn off burner. Add maple syrup (optional), blueberries and seasoned dressing; stir until well combined. Allow to reach room temperature.
- Preheat oven to 375°F. Prepare muffin pan with Canola cooking oil spray at the bottoms of each cup.
- Fold beaten eggs into cooled meat, vegetable and dressing mix. Spoon into prepared muffin cups.
- Bake on middle rack of preheated 375°F for 20 minutes until internal temperature reaches 165°F and lightly browned on top of Stuffins. Remove from oven, cool slightly, remove from muffin pan and cool.
Tips:
These Stuffins can be frozen then microwaved for one minute on high as a quick, holiday breakfast treat.
This can also be a traditional casserole stuffing recipe:
Eliminate the eggs, transfer the warm meat, vegetable and dressing mix into a prepared 9" X 11" pan, bake on middle rack of preheated 375°F oven for 20 minutes until internal temperature reaches 165°F. Remove from oven and serve as Bacon-Blueberry Stuffing with turkey.
